1SDA100073R1 ABB: C.BREAKER TMAX XT2H 160 FIXED THREE-POLE WITH FRONT TERMINALS AND SOLID-STATE RELEASE IN AC EKIP DIP LIG R 100 A

Current Type
AC
Electrical Durability
120 cycles per hour | 8000 cycle
Mechanical Durability
240 cycles per hour | 25000 cycle
Number of Poles
3P
Opening Time
CB with SOR 30 ms | CB with UVR 30 ms
Order Multiple
1 piece
Power Loss
at Rated Operating Conditions per Pole 8.1 W
Rated Current (In)
100 A
Rated Impulse Withstand Voltage (Uimp)
8 kV
Rated Insulation Voltage (Ui)
1000 V
Rated Operational Voltage
690 V AC
Rated Service Short-Circuit Breaking Capacity (Ics)
(220 V AC) 100 kA | (230 V AC) 100 kA | (240 V AC) 100 kA | (380 V AC) 70 kA | (415 V AC) 70 kA | (440 V AC) 65 kA | (500 V AC) 50 kA | (525 V AC) 30 kA | (690 V AC) 15 kA
Rated Ultimate Short-Circuit Breaking Capacity (Icu)
(220 V AC) 100 kA | (230 V AC) 100 kA | (240 V AC) 100 kA | (380 V AC) 70 kA | (415 V AC) 70 kA | (440 V AC) 65 kA | (500 V AC) 50 kA | (525 V AC) 30 kA | (690 V AC) 15 kA
Rated Uninterrupted Current (Iu)
160 A
Release
Ekip Dip LIG
Release Type
EL
Short-Circuit Performance Level
H
Standards
IEC60947-2
Sub-type
XT2
Terminal Connection Type
Front
